How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Falmouth?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Falmouth Studio Apartments | $2,215 | $1,653 | $2,999 |
Falmouth 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$1,399 | $2,753 |
Falmouth 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,987 | $1,499 | $3,350 |
Falmouth 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,449 | $1,923 | $3,525 |
Falmouth 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,150 | $2,150 | $2,150 |

Largest Available Falmouth and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Falmouth, VA is found at Riverside Manor Apartments in the Riverwalk neighborhood and is 1,520 square feet priced from $2,013. Silver Collection At Carl D Silver in the Sherwood Estates ne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,233 square feet and currently listed start at $2,595.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Falmouth:

Cheapest Available Falmouth and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of June 19,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Falmouth, VA is the 2A Model starting from $1,649 at The Commons at Cowan Boulevard in the Chatham Landing neighborhood. The second most affordable Falmouth 2 Bedroom is the Elwood V Model at MAA Greenbrier starting at $1,733 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Falmouth is currently $1,987.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Falmouth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Falmouth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Falmouth is $1,987.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Falmouth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Falmouth is a 1,520 square feet unit starting from $2,013 at Riverside Manor Apartments.
What is the average size for Falmouth 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Falmouth is currently 924 sq ft.
